This video provides a comprehensive real-world test of Ford's Blue Cruise system in a 2021 Mustang Mach-E GT Performance Edition. The reviewer, using his personal vehicle, highlights that Blue Cruise is a Level 2 driver assistance feature requiring driver attention. While it offers hands-free driving on over 130,000 miles of mapped North American roads, its performance is inconsistent in challenging conditions such as heavy traffic, bright sunlight, construction zones, and sharp curves. The system frequently disengages or prompts the driver to take over, especially when lane lines are faint or obscured, or in direct sunlight. The reviewer notes that Blue Cruise is less capable than Tesla's system, disengaging more readily in turns and not offering automated lane changes (though this is planned for future updates). A key positive is its proactive driver monitoring via an infrared-equipped camera, which is more stringent than Tesla's approach. The system's reliance on clear lane markings and its inability to navigate exits independently are noted limitations. Overall, the reviewer finds Blue Cruise functional as advertised but emphasizes the need for drivers to understand its limitations and actively collaborate with the system.
